Authors: Florian Lambinet, Zahra Sharif Khodaei, M.H. Aliabadi
Abstract: This work focuses on diagnostic methodologies for composite repair patch based on structural health monitoring (SHM) technology. Methodologies based on ultrasonic guided waves (GW) are developed and assessed for monitoring composite scarf repair with piezoelectric transducers. The effectiveness of the RAPID (reconstruction algorithm for probabilistic inspection of defects) algorithm was investigated for adhesively bonded composite patch repair. A composite scarf repair has been weakened by 4-point bending fatigue test and impacted after to generate a Barely Visible Damage (BVID). Both conventional RAPID technique, which requires baseline signals, and the Scaling Subtraction Method (SSM) were applied to detect damage in the bondline. The conventional method showed good performance for defect detection and localization whereas the SSM gives encouraging results for non-linear baseline-free RAPID.

Authors: Ke Jie Fu, Qi Bei Bao, Yun Feng, Li Sheng Yang, Chang Sheng Feng, Song Zhang
Abstract: a new method for rapid detection of formaldehyde has been developed in this research. Under this method, the formaldehyde solution has condensation reaction with 4-amino-3-hydrazine-5-mercapto-1,2,4-triazole (AHMT) and is oxidized by potassium periodate to produce purple chemical compounds. The method for rapid detection of the formaldehyde content in textiles has been optimized after researching primary influencing factors and considering the specimen extraction effect in GB/T 2912.1-2009.This method is sensitive, accurate and fast, taking only 12.5min, 9.6 times faster than the method provided in GB/T 2912.1-2009.

Authors: Jie Wang, Kai Zhang
Abstract: At present, there are many commonly used maximum power point tracking (MPPT) control methods for solar photovoltaic system which have different degrees of output fluctuations. In order to solve the problem and improve the response speed further, a novel MPPT algorithm based on the extreme learning machine was put forward in this paper. Using the extreme learning machine which has small error, fast speed and simple structure train a mathematical model with the environmental temperature and light intensity as input and the maximum power point as output, the model can be used as the controller of the photovoltaic cells. The simulation results show that the error of the model meets the requirements, when the ambient temperature and light intensity change, it can respond quickly so as to photovoltaic cells work at the maximum power point and operate stably.

Authors: Jia Dong Hua, Liang Zeng, Jing Lin, Wen Shi
Abstract: Guided wave tomography is an attractive tool for the detection and monitoring of the critical area in a structure. Using signal difference coefficient (SDC) as the tomographic feature, RAPID (Reconstruction Algorithm for the Probabilistic Inspection of Damage) is an effective and flexible tomography algorithm. In this algorithm, signal changes are exclusively attributed to the structural variation. However, external environment factors like water loading or oil loading also change signals significantly. The presence of anti-symmetric mode with a predominant out of plane displacement makes it very sensitive to these interferences and leads to false alarms. In this paper, Lamb wave is excited in the low-frequency domain, where only the fundamental modes A0 and S0 exist. The significant difference in group velocity between the two modes makes it possible to separate them in time domain. A new method is proposed to extract pure S0 mode signal as valid measurement data to improve the algorithm in addressing false alarm caused by water loading. The results of the experiment demonstrate that the improved algorithm has the capability of providing accurate identification of damage in the presence of water loading.

Authors: Stelian Brad, Emilia Brad, Cosmin Ioanes
Abstract: In order to set up well-structured multitasking robot application programs careful planning is required. Robot programming languages (e.g. Karel, RAPID, Melfa, SimPro, etc.) vary from robot to robot constructor. General planning tools used in software development (e.g. UML, IDEF, etc.) require adequate professional skills and a special way of thinking such that robot programmers to apply and adapt them to the specificity of each robot programming language. Customized and intuitive planning tools of robot applications with regard to each particular programming language seem to be preferred by ordinary robot programmers and operators when facing with the development of complex robot tasks. This paper introduces such a tool in relation to the RAPIDTM programming language, specific to ABB robot models. Its effectiveness is revealed in a case study.
